What's The Definition Of Unsaddle?
[v] remove the saddle from; of animals; "They unsaddled their mounts"
Synonyms | Synonyms for Unsaddle: offsaddle Related Terms | Find terms related to Unsaddle: See Also | remove | take | take away | withdraw Unsaddle In Webster's Dictionary \Un*sad"dle\, v. t. [1st pref. un- + saddle.]
1. To strip of a saddle; to take the saddle from, as a horse.
2. To throw from the saddle; to unhorse.
